Abstract
With the fast growth of wireless networking in population, security became an essential issue for data privacy. Encryption mechanisms relying on static key structure, such as WEP (802.11) and TKIP (802.1x), are vulnerable to key cracking by capturing wireless packets. Although new standards have been developed to fulfill this gap, there is still a lack of a stable security protocol. In this paper, we present a light-weight and solid i-key encryption protocol to enhance the security of wireless communication. With this dynamic re-keying mechanism, only valid clients can decrypt the ciphertext and reveal the message by using the unique secret i-key they have to prevent the sensitive data from being accessed by unauthorized recipients. In addition, test results indicate that i-key protocol can perform efficiently in different wireless environment.
